GSTRING - GESTION DES CHAINES DE CARACTÈRES

Signaler
Messages postés
15021
Date d'inscription
lundi 11 juillet 2005
Statut
Modérateur
Dernière intervention
19 avril 2021
-
Messages postés
15021
Date d'inscription
lundi 11 juillet 2005
Statut
Modérateur
Dernière intervention
19 avril 2021
-
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/50386-gstring-gestion-des-chaines-de-caracteres

Messages postés
15021
Date d'inscription
lundi 11 juillet 2005
Statut
Modérateur
Dernière intervention
19 avril 2021
94
Hello,
J'ai parcouru vite fait le code et j'ai quelques remarques:
- je trouve que ça manque de commentaires explicatifs. Par exemple, pour la fonction Count, je ne comprends pas à quoi elle sert (case sensitive en plus..)
- pourquoi avoir doubler des fonctions? Size() = Length(), non? D'une manière générale, il faut éviter d'en faire trop, pour limiter les apparitions de bugs
- il y a des endroits où tu peux optimiser. Par exemple, dans la fonction LastIndexOf(), tu peux remplacer ta boucle for par une boucle while()...

Next step: gestion de l'unicode?

Bon travail,
Buno.